Japan’s government has issued a rare “megaquake advisory” after a 7.5 magnitude earthquake struck off the country’s northern coast on Tuesday, warning that a much larger offshore quake could generate a towering tsunami in the coming days.

Japan ’s weather agency has issued its highest-level warning that a megaquake could follow Monday’s 7.5-magnitude tremor. Authorities urged anyone living near the Pacific coast to remain vigilant throughout the coming week and to prepare evacuation plans in case they need to flee their homes.
